Спецкурс. Теория разработки программного обеспечения (А.А. Изюмов, 2013 г., 174 c.)

Лабораторная работа №1
Цель работы: Целью данной работы является построение Use Case диаграммы выбранной предметной области.
Задание:
Необходимо создать диаграмму прецедентов в инструментальной среде UML редактора, следуя описанным принципам работы с системой. Объектом автоматизации является процесс, выбранный из Приложения А.
Выбор варианта осуществляется по общим правилам с использованием следующей формулы:
V = (N * k) div 100, где: V — искомый номер варианта (при V = 0 выбирается максимальный вариант),
N — общее количество вариантов по контрольной работе, k — значение двух последних цифр пароля (число в диапазоне 0..99), div — целочисленное деление (дробная часть отбрасывается).
Документы отчетности сдаются на проверку в электронной форме и включают в себя:
• файл модели;
• текстовый документ, содержащий описание потоков событий прецедентов моделируемой информационной системы.
Допускается документирование потоков событий и основных проектных решений в рамках среды UML редактора с использованием окна документирования.
Помните, выходной файл данной модели будет использоваться и в остальных работах, поэтому заранее определите, какие диаграммы будут использоваться в данном проекте.

Лабораторная работа №2
Цель работы: Целью данной работы является построение диаграммы классов.
Задание: Необходимо создать диаграмму, следуя описанным принципам работы с системой. Объектом автоматизации является тот же процесс, что и в предыдущей работе. Результат — дополнительная диаграмма в уже существующем файле проекта.

Лабораторная работа №3
Цель работы: Целью данной работы является построение диаграммы последовательности
Задание: В вашей модели создайте не менее 3-х диаграмм последовательности.

Лабораторная работа №4
Цель работы: Целью работы является разработка схемы базы данных выбранной предметной области, её построение и разработка СУБД для базы данных, построенной в ходе предыдущей лабораторной работы
Задание:
Разработать СУБД для базы данных, описанной в виде полноатрибутной модели. Программные средства для проектирования СУБД подобрать самостоятельно.
Варианты языка разработки СУБД: PHP, Object Pacsal, C++, Python и т. д. Сложность — от двух таблиц готовой БД.

СПИСОК ТЕМ ДЛЯ ЛАБОРАТОРНЫХ РАБОТ
1. Кафе.
2. Железнодорожная касса.
3. Автосервис.
4. Больница.
5. Ветеринарная клиника.
6. Спартакиада.
7. Конкурс красоты.
8. Библиотека.
9. Авиакасса.
10. Магазин промышленных товаров.
11. Банк.
12. Прачечная.
13. Речной порт.
14. Гостиница.
15. Фотосалон.
16. Морг.
17. Политическая партия.
18. Отдел кадров.
19. Аэропорт.
20. Компьютерный магазин



ОТПРАВИТЬ ЗАЯВКУ
(уточните наименование работ: ТКР, ЛР, ККР, КП, ЭКЗ,
2 последние цифры пароля
к какому числу нужно выполнить работы)

Имя

Email



© 2009-2024 TusurBiz